Lindamood-Bell Learning Processes has an employee rating of 3.0 out of 5 stars, based on 873 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have an average working experience there. The Lindamood-Bell Learning Processes employ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Education industry (3.7 stars).

Pros

It's rewarding to work in an environment where you can really see the progress you're helping the students make, and you gain patience, creativity and resilience skills.

Cons

The clients are often difficult, especially if you are not trained in working with people with autism or other disorders. It requires a lot of patience, flexibility, and potentially little hours.
